I lived in this during the last weeks of pregnancy

I almost literally lived in this piece during the last few weeks of my pregnancy when nothing else fit or was comfortable. It's easy to put on, and you can accessorize to feel somewhat put together, or take a nap in it. Dealer's choice. It did seem to run a bit large (from RTR recommendations). I should've gone with my normal size pre pregnancy (medium) rather than the large that was recommended.

Super comfortable maternity jumpsuit

I picked this for a maternity outfit on a whim not really expecting it to fit me or look right but I really loved it and received a lot of compliments! It's a soft jersey fabric which is super comfy and it's loose fitting. I wore it through all stages of my pregnancy and ended up buying it from the retailer, which was a little cheaper than RTR's price. Highly recommend! I normally wear a size 0 and the XS was perfect.
